With over 50 laboratories and more than 40 service centers nationwide, Eurofins Environment Testing provides full-service environmental analysis across all 50 states. Our network supports public and private clients—including DoD, DOE, and municipalities—through robust logistics and continuous investment in people, technology, and infrastructure.


We offer comprehensive testing for air, water, soil, sediment, tissue, and waste, covering a wide range of analytes including PFAS, metals, VOCs/SVOCs, dioxins/furans, radiochemicals, and more.

Eurofins Environmental Testing Southwest is searching for a Laboratory Technician II in Tustin, CA

The Sample Preparation Laboratory Technician II is responsible for utilizing general laboratory methods, techniques, equipment, and instrumentation in compliance with Eurofins Quality Assurance programs and SOP’s, to weigh, digest and prepare soil and water samples for GC and GCMS analysis.

Laboratory Technician II responsibilities include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Sample preparation duties may include, but are not limited to the following responsibilities:
    • Evaluate backlog and prioritize daily workload based on required due dates and holding times.
    • Retrieve samples from sample storage for preparation.
    • Weigh and measure sample aliquots for preparation
    • Document required sample preparation details and observations
    • Prepare reagents and standards for daily use
    • Maintain and troubleshoot laboratory equipment in accordance with the laboratory quality assurance program
    • Represent the department in an informed and professional manner during internal and external audit events
    • Perform daily duties while adhering to the environmental health and safety policies
    • Wash and prepare laboratory glassware as needed
    • Perform general housekeeping within the laboratory to maintain an organized and safe working environment
    • Actively communicate with department manager, analytical team and project managers about job status, rush ETA, sample matrix issues, holding time etc.
